Description

Small in stature, relentless in hunger — the zombie gnome shambles forward with arms outstretched, its mouth agape in a silent, endless scream.

  • ✔ 32mm scale resin miniature, printed fresh to order in the UK
  • ✔ Supplied unpainted and ready to prime
  • ✔ Compatible with D&D, Pathfinder, and all tabletop RPGs
  • ✔ Equally at home on the gaming table or the display shelf

This is the second pose in our Zombie Gnome range, and it captures something genuinely unsettling: the frantic, grasping lurch of a creature that was once cunning and quick, now driven only by rot and instinct. Bare-footed, dressed in little more than tattered wrappings and a crude loincloth, this gnome corpse reaches forward with both clawed hands — one adorned with a bangle, a grim remnant of its former life. The sculpt's emaciated frame, boil-marked skin, and wide, hollow-socketed face make it a compelling addition to any undead encounter or display shelf.

Zombie gnomes work brilliantly as part of a shambling horde, as minions for a necromancer villain, or as something more tragic — the remnants of a gnomish settlement wiped out by plague or dark magic. This pose specifically reads as mid-lunge, which gives it tremendous energy on the tabletop. Whether grouped in numbers or used as a lone, eerie wanderer, it tells a story without a single word of narration.

Encounter Hook:
The party arrives in the gnomish tinkering-village of Copperbell to find the workshops silent and the streets empty — until, from behind an overturned cart, a small figure rounds the corner, arms outstretched, moving with horrible purpose. There are more behind it. Many more.
